What this trial measures
- Number of Adverse drug reaction (ADRs)From baseline (week 0) to end of study (between 1 week and a maximum of 10 years)
Measured as count of events.
- Incident NeoplasmFrom baseline (week 0) to end of study (between 1 week and a maximum of 10 years)
Measured as number of participants (yes/no).
- Incident Diabetes Mellitus type 2From baseline (week 0) to end of study (between 1 week and a maximum of 10 years)
Measured as number of participants (yes/no).
